This is exactly why people price policing is ridiculous. "They're not worth that", well, looks like to someone they were, so I guess you're wrong? I'm with transprtr4u you couldn't pay ME to take a Fish Tales, but if people want to pay money for them then they are worth more than kindling and parts I guess. Who am I to say?

The market may be trending downwards...or maybe it isn't, because Godzilla is still selling above NIB value, Pirates is still priced in 20k+ range, people are still buying restored 90's B/W games for over 10k. The reality is that people are still buying games, and those games are still (more often than not) priced higher than they used to be. No matter how much you hope and wish prices will go back down, the only thing that's gonna change that is if people stop buying games. And, I've said it before and I'll say it again, ya'll are a bunch of junkies and won't stop buying pins.

Judge Dredd price just went up, $49,250.

In our show people like donating their games as they usually get them back in the same or better shape. Especially the tournament machines as we really dial them in. Of course transport can be hard of them and we are finding better ways each year to do it better but 500 plays on a game is nothing these machines are meant to be played over 100,000 plays. Overall there are just some really good people in the community that believe in the hobby and want to continue to grow it.
